When a lease is coming up for renewal, a Landlord's Notice of Non-Renewal tells your tenants that their lease will not be renewed and that they will need to move out when the lease ends. As a landlord, one of the hardest things is dealing with an unwanted tenant, but giving notice of non-renewal is a way out if you need one. Many times a landlord will allow a tenant to remain on the property simply because it is easier than trying to replace them. But you shouldn't feel obligated to renew a lease with tenants who are not living up to their responsibilities. When a lease is about to expire, the notice of non-renewal is the first step to getting better tenants.

Use the Landlord's Notice of Non-Renewal document if:

  • You do not want to offer your tenant a lease extension.
